How to Prepare Your Composite Door For Paint Repair
Paint your Composite Door Paint Repair door to give it an attractive and fresh appearance. It will also shield it from harsh weather conditions. This will prevent moisture infiltration, which can lead swelling and warping.
However painting a door made of composite requires thorough preparation and a cautious application to ensure it lasts long. An incorrect application could cause damage to the material, leaving it susceptible to environmental damage.
Preparation
If your composite front door is looking faded and dull you can paint it over to give it a fresh new appearance. This will also help keep the surface from deterioration and weathering. It is important to prepare the surface properly before painting. This includes cleaning, sanding, and applying the proper primer. If you don't properly prepare the surface the paint won't adhere properly. It could peel or flake over time.
The first step in the process of preparation is to thoroughly clean the door. Begin by washing the door using warm water, a small amount of sugar soap, and a detergent specifically designed to clean dirt. After cleaning the door, dry it with an absorbent towel.
After cleaning the door, it's recommended to lightly sand the door. This will roughen the surface and allow the paint to stick better. Use a fine-grit surface when sanding and remove any dust that has accumulated after sanding.
The next step is to apply a primer on the surface of the door. This will help the paint adhere to the door and protect it from moisture. After the primer has dried, you can proceed with painting the door. It is recommended to apply multiple coats, and allow each one to dry completely before applying the next. Be sure to adhere to the manufacturer's guidelines for drying times.
It's a good idea to seal the door after it's been painted. This will prevent water from getting into the door and damaging the surface. Sealants are available in a variety of forms that include polyurethane and silicone. Be sure to select one that is specifically made for exterior doors and compatible with your specific door.
If you're required to paint your composite door is dependent on you and the style of your home. If you decide to repaint the door made of composite, make sure to use the right methods of preparation to ensure a durable finish.
Cleaning
The first step in any painting project is cleaning the surface. Composite doors are susceptible to grit, grime and other contaminants that could make it difficult for paint to adhere properly. This is the reason it's essential to regularly clean them to avoid damage and ensure that they're clean and ready to paint. You can clean them with soapy, warm water using a soft microfibre or sponge. It is recommended to wash them once a month or more depending on how filthy your door gets, and it will help keep them looking as nice as new.
Avoid using solvent-based or abrasive cleaners on your composite doors as these can cause damage to the surface, and can cause discolouration and structural problems over time. Instead, you should employ mild cleaning agents such as sugar soap. These are typically available as sprays or wipes that can be purchased from many DIY stores. After you've cleaned your door, it's crucial to wash it with clean water to get rid of any remaining cleaning solution or dirt. Be sure to dry your door with a soft, wet cloth before proceeding to the next step.
Once the door is dry then you need to lightly sand the door to make it ready for painting. This will roughen up the surface, and help the paint adhere better to the door. Follow the manufacturer's guidelines for the amount of sanding that is required. Once you've sanded your door, make sure to rinse it again with clean water and allow it to dry completely before proceeding with the painting process.
Having your composite door painted is a great way to add some colour and style to your home, but it's equally important to properly maintain it to keep it looking its best. Regular cleaning with a mild cleaning solution and a soft cloth or sponge is crucial and so is a sealant. Make sure you use a sealant that is that is safe for composite doors and follow the manufacturer’s instructions on application and drying time.
